The Woomh Files: a journey of almost ten years

The Woomh FilesAltera Orbe started releasing EPs and minialbums back in 2012 under the special Woomh category, trying to offer to the artist another way to create and release music on an altertive format that allowed a faster develope. The idea was to catch ideas in distinction to the classic album format and time lenght, being perfect for little live performances, smaller conceptual works, medium-form pieces with identity, etc. In the end a lot of ideas fitted the format that sometimes was also possible to have a physical release in mini-CD (210Mb/ 24 minutes).

Ran Kirlian has released a dozen mini-albums in the Woomh series, being a few of them even earlier to the Woomh concept, ranging from year 2009 to 2019. Now he released an album collecting pieces from each of these mini-works with a fine mix that melt them together and also incluides some extrastuff like a pair if unreleased tracks and 12 pages booklet containing a lot of information about the making of these recordings and their artworks. It acts both like a sample of the music pictured on the Woomh series and as a portrait of a ten years journey across Ran Kirlian music.

Ran Kirlian | White Angel

White AngelWhite Angel is the alternative name of the Lyra-8 synthesizer created by Soma Laboratory. It is, also, the title of Ran Kirlian newest minialbum, as the Lyra-8 is the main instrument used on the tracks included on it. This project contains 40+ minutes of sonic explorations beyond ambient boundaries, from experimental and drone to subtle melodies and drifting atmospheres.

Synths: Soma Laboratory Lyra-8, Quasimidi Polymorph, Access Virus Indigo, (track 5)
Effects: Waves Trueverb, TC Electronic M3000 and Valhalla Shimmer

The Many Futures of Ran Kirlian

IMany Futures 1n September 2018 Ran Kirlian released a new EP with 3 tracks entitled «Many Futures issue nº1». Beyond the naive title, its cover art and layout looked closer to a vintage sci-fi magazine than to the typical Woomh albums. Also it did not followed the catalog number of the series, however it is an Altera Orbe minialbum release, but belonging to a new conceptual series, parallel to the Woomh series.

Many Futures is a series of mini albums that collects Ran Kirlian musical and sonic impressions around years of science fiction literature reading.

As Ran says: «More than just a soundtrack for those stories, these tracks are my personal vision of the future portrayed by the authors on their stories. That’s where the series title comes, as the music contained in this and further volumes flows around the many alternative futures of the humankind.»

Ran Kirlian | La Cueva de las Almas Perdidas

La CuevaThe first solo Woomh in two years from Ran Kirlian (apart from the Many Futures minialbums) is entitled «a Cueva de las Almas Perdidas» (The Cave of the Lost Souls). It is a experimental atmnospheric minialbum exclusively based on layers and loops of voices treated with different reverb effects. The result os a consistent space full of mystery and mysticism and a charming ambient experience.

All drones, sounds and choirs were done with Ran Kirlian’s voice and, eventually, his son’s voice and a rotating corrugated tube.

This minialbum is dedicated to all the victims during and after Franquism whose corpses were never found.

OVSCVIRIA by Ran Kirlian & Landru

OSCVIRIAAfter 7 years from their previous collaborative project, Waterfront, Landru and Ran Kirlian join forces again for a new project, this time in minialbum format, entitled OVSCVIRIA.

While released in 2019, this project started back in 2014. While the initial bases and lines were totally clear since beginning and the first mix was ready in 2015, it took few years to complete it. It was taken and abandoned several times during months between other projects and priority commitments from both artists. After finding time to complete this inspirational work during the second half of 2018, it finally found a launch window during 2019.

OBSCVIRIA is essentially a dark-ambient minialbum that combines dark soundworlds, sequences and rhythms by Ran Kirlian and Landru.

Landru: analog and digital synthesizers, samplers & grooves
Ran Kirlian: analog and digital synthesizers, samplers & voices

Ran Kirlian – Nested DreamsNested Dreams

Dark ambient minialbum based on complex textures and treated field recordings. This tracks have been deeply inspired by the work of Brian Lustmord, Voice of Eye and Yen Pox.

This minialbum also includes music from unreleased projects that finally found its place in this little release.

IxtabRan Kirlian – Ixtab

Dark-ambient/noise-drone minialbum based on live recordings and inspired by the figure of the Mayan goddess Ixtab.

This album goes far beyond the drone-ambient styles and explores raw landscapes with more aggresive sounds and distortion, a bit influenced by the early work of the Australian multimedia artist Abre Ojos.

MaalesbarkRan Kirlian – Maalesbark

Maalesbark is an electronic music minialbum dominated by modular synth sequences and few extreme frequencies. All tracks recorded live with an Eurorack modular synthesizer + friends.

The track Sanctus is a revisited version of a track included in the Ran Kirlian album Shore of Darkness from the year 2000. The track entitled Benthos, was recorded live and one of the first Ran Kirlian live performances to be posted on Youtube, back in 2009.

Vauxia Errante – La Création du Monde

La Création du Monde is the title of the last recording by dark-ambient artist Vauxia Errante, a long form track full of delicated details and intrincated textures conforming a mesmerizing exploration of sonic realms. This is the 3th volume in the Woomh EP series by Altera Orbe artists.

All music composed, performed, recorded and mixed by Vauxia Errante in 2012 and mastered by Ran Kirlian at The Blue_Room in 2013.

The Woomh Series is a special product line which items are presented in mini-albums formats, containing unique, strange and isolated musical passages from the artists belonging to Altera Orbe or even special guests.
